Comment:

 Okay, so this is not content process related which is good. However, I
 can't reproduce your problem, neither on Linux nor on my Windows 7
 machine: after New Identity there are no blob resources left for me. Do
 you have by chance some steps to reproduce? I just surfed a bit and once
 the blob URI(s) showed up I hit New Identity and as fast as I could I
 measured again in the new session and found nothing.

 What do those URIs show if you load them in a new tab? For instance,
 blob:null/aea79f34-6db6-4940-a978-c07c910a552a shows the DuckDuckGo icon.
 If you look further and set `memory.blob_report.stack_frames` to a non-
 null value (I used 10) you'll get even stack frames showing where the URI
 is coming from. In my case it was search related.
